起因
不知道大家有没有21:9甚至16:10的显示器。一般的视频都是16:9,老一点的《家庭教师》则是4:3,大家去看b站的时候,b站只会有4:3和16:9的强制比例,并没有拉伸选项,爱奇艺也只有100%,没有客户端的“满屏”选项。
我个人有16:10的显示器,16:9拉伸成16:10基本上看不出来,所以拉伸只对4:3有影响,我个人觉得这种情况下,能拉伸视频完美利用屏幕的每个像素,比视频是成比例的重要,大家是不是这么看的?
步骤
首先,要找到一个能加载自定义css文件的浏览器,例如cent browser。
自己用文本编辑器写一个以css文件结尾的文件内容为
video{
object-fit: fill
}
这个是H5的视频内容拉伸属性,有点惨的是修改不了Flash的。
注意,不要留有txt的后缀。
保存后用浏览器加载就行了。
效果对比图
未使用前:
使用后:
可以看见,上下两便存在黑色边的区域被视频拉伸填满了。
Firefox设置全屏
- about:config里面设置toolkit.legacyUserProfileCustomizations.stylesheets为true
- about:support里面打开配置文件夹,在里面新建一个chrome目录,在目录里面放置一个userContent.css文件,然后将上面的内容放进去。
- https://wiki.archlinux.org/index.php/Firefox/Tweaks#General_user_interface_CSS_settings 这是信息来源